Agatha Abigail "Aggie" Barkhouse
Agatha Abigail “Aggie” (Snyder) Barkhouse, age 94, of Bridgewater and formerly of Martin’s Point, passed away July 11, 2020.

Born in Halfway Cove, she was the younger daughter of the late George and Maude (Dort) Snyder.

She was the last surviving member of her family of 11 children.

She was predeceased by her loving husband of 65 years, Lloyd Edwin Barkhouse, who passed away January 28, 2009.

She was also predeceased by brothers, Abner, Charles, Chester, Leslie, Ernest, Douglas, Basil; sisters, Catherine, Evelyn, Myrtle.

Agatha worked at Moir’s Ltd. where she met her husband, Lloyd. She also worked for a number of years at Eatons.

It was the wish of Aggie and Lloyd to have their ashes buried together in St. Martin’s Anglican Cemetery, Martin’s River where, due to Covid-19 restrictions, a private graveside service for immediate family only, observing social distancing, will be held 11am, Thursday, July 23rd.

Memorial donations are requested to be made to the Parish of St. Martin’s through Grace Anglican Church, Chester Basin; St. James the Martyr Anglican Church, Halfway Cove or a charity of choice.

Our thanks to Ridgewood and Ryan Hall for their care of Aggie over the past three years.
